Apple Puffed Pancake

  • 2 C milk
  • 8 large eggs
  • 1/4 C honey
  • 2 t vanilla
  • 1 t salt
  • 1/2 t cinnamon
  • 1 1/3 C flour
  • 1/2 C butter, melted
  • 4 apples, peeled and thinly sliced
  • 1/4 C brown sugar or sucanat

Place butter in the bottom of two 9×13″ baking dishes, with apple slices on top.  Bake at 425 degrees until apples and butter are bubbling (about 10 minutes).  Meanwhile, whirl all remaining ingredients in the blender, except the brown sugar.  Pour liquid over bubbly apples in dish.  Sprinkle with brown sugar.  Bake for 20 minutes, allowing the “pancake” to puff up.  Serve with syrup (or fruit jams), and fresh bread or toast.
